Is The Collection at Riverside Apartments Safe?
Not really — crime is above the national average. The Collection at Riverside Apartments in Austin, TX has a safety grade of C-. The overall crime index is 192, which is 92%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the Austin average (crime index 83), The Collection at Riverside Apartments is 109%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.
Looking at specific crime types, murder is the most elevated concern (index: 188, 88%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 57).
